  10. That's exactly what I was trying. It fails with walls of different heights, leaves the upper portion uncapped.

     

    I ended up duplicating the taller of the parapet walls and making one the same height as the lower, and one just the upper portion. Was able to join the lower 2 walls in an L and then cap the upper. Its pretty close.
